Traveling to Iceland often begins with that crucial first step: getting from Keflavik Airport into Reykjavik. If you’re considering a private transfer, you’ll want to know what to expect before booking. We’ve gathered insights from numerous reviews and details about this service to help you decide if it’s the right fit for your trip.
What immediately catches the eye is the top-rated reputation — this transfer service boasts a perfect 5.0 rating from 95 reviews, with 97% of travelers recommending it. That kind of consistent praise is rare and worth paying attention to, especially for a service that costs around $187 per group, which covers up to three people. Two things you’ll likely love: the professional punctuality and the comfort of a private vehicle. On the flip side, some might consider the price slightly premium compared to public options, but the convenience and peace of mind are often worth it.
This service is especially suited to travelers who want a stress-free start or end to their Iceland adventure. Whether you’re arriving late at night or catching an early flight, pre-booking a private ride means no waiting around for taxis or navigating unfamiliar public transportation. It’s perfect for families, groups, or anyone who values comfort and reliability over saving a few dollars.

The Experience on the Day

Booking is straightforward — just enter your flight number, and the service’s flight monitoring system ensures your driver is ready for you, whether your flight is early, delayed, or on time. Reviewers frequently mention punctuality as a standout feature. Julia, who left a glowing review, praised how her driver was right on time at 4 am, helping with bags and making the early start less stressful.
The vehicle itself is described as spotless and comfortable, with ample space for luggage, which is great if you’re traveling with more bags or family. Multiple reviews highlight the professionalism and friendliness of drivers, with one noting they were like a tour guide, sharing interesting facts during the drive. Even when flights are delayed, the driver waits patiently, demonstrating a level of care and flexibility that’s hard to find elsewhere.

FAQ
Is this transfer available for both arrivals and departures?
Yes, you can book it for either arriving or departing flights, providing flexibility to your schedule.
How do I know the driver will be on time?
The service monitors your flight, so your driver will be waiting regardless of delays or early arrivals.
What’s included in the service?
It includes door-to-door service, a private vehicle, meet-and-greet assistance, and flight monitoring.
Are the vehicles climate-controlled?
Yes, all vehicles are climate-controlled, ensuring comfort no matter the weather outside.
Can I cancel this service?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und.
Is this service suitable for large groups?
It’s designed for groups of up to 3 people, which makes it ideal for small parties.
Is this service good value for the price?
Based on reviews, the convenience, comfort, and dependability make it a worthwhile investment.
Are service animals allowed?
Yes, service animals are permitted.
What if my flight is delayed?
The driver will wait for you, as flight times are monitored and factored into the scheduling.
Where does the driver meet you at the airport?
The driver usually waits with your name outside the baggage claim area, making it easy to spot.
